The package contained approximately 612 grams of heroin. On December 4, 2015, officers from the New York State Police intercepted a suspicious FedEx package addressed to a fictitious name at 164 Curtis St. During the investigation, officers conducted multiple controlled purchases from the defendants. Rodriguez, who is handling the case, stated that according to the complaint, the Drug Enforcement Administration and Rochester Police have been investigating the drug trafficking activities of the three defendants for nine months. Through collaborated efforts, law enforcement identified and arrested a major cocaine source of supply contaminating the Greater Rochester New York area.”Īssistant U.S. Any person in any way involved in trafficking these toxins should expect to be prosecuted to the fullest extent of the law.”ĭEA Special Agent in Charge James Hunt stated, “An eight-month investigation into an illicit family drug business resulted in 14 firearms and 9 kilograms of cocaine seized and taken off our streets as well as the arrest of three drug traffickers. “Thanks to exceptional police work, not only have massive quantities of these ‘assassins’ been removed, but even larger amounts of equally dangerous crack and powder cocaine. “As all in our community know, the most deadly substances killing our residents consist of heroin and firearms,” said U.S. The charges carry a mandatory minimum 15 years in prison, a maximum of life and a $10,000,000 fine.

announced today that Blake Rivera, 31, of Greece, NY, his brother Chayanne Rivera, 25, of Gates, NY, and their father, Victor Rivera, 51, of Rochester, NY, were arrested and charged by criminal complaint with conspiracy to possess with intent to distribute and to distribute five kilograms or more of cocaine, 280 grams or more of crack cocaine and 100 grams of heroin, and possession of firearms in furtherance of drug trafficking.
